Although the novella "Breakfast at Tiffany's" was set in the early 40's, the movie based on the novella, that established Audrey Hepburn as an eternal style icon, was set in the early 60's - at the time it was filmed. That's why I chose this as inspiration for my hommage to the 60's!



I started with three thin coats of Delush Polish "Amazemint" on all my nails, except my ring finger, on which I applied two coats of Sinful Colors "Snow Me White" and stamped with QA38. I sealed it all in with Seche Vite. Then I applied a little white bow, that Ms. Sparkle gifter me, on my middle finger.

Delush "Amazemint" is just that - it applies easily and dries fast. It does need some glitter food though, before top coating it!
